CITY OF MESQUITE is Hiring a Property Maintenance Inspector Near Mesquite, TX

Salary: $20.04/hr. minimum - $24.55/hr. midpoint (Depending on qualifications) 
To perform a variety of tasks associated with the inspection of existing single-family residential properties and to enforce minimum property standards within adopted codes and ordinances.

SUPERVISION:
General supervision is provided by the Manager of Property Maintenance and Rental Inspections.
  1. All behaviors comply with the Code of Conduct and Rules of Behavior outlined in Chapter 8 of the General Government Policies and Procedures Manual. Adheres to assigned work schedule as outlined in city and department attendance policies and procedures.
  2. Conduct exterior and interior inspections of existing single-family and multi-family residential dwellings. Enforce compliance with applicable codes, ordinances and regulations; recommend modifications and adjustments as necessary to comply with minimum property standards.
  3. Inspect previously occupied rental single-family dwellings for code compliance; approve inspected dwellings for rental property license.
  4. Inspect multi-family dwellings for code compliance; approve annual license issuance. 
  5. Inspect all dwelling exteriors for minimum code compliance within designated neighborhoods to include but not limited to broken windows, roof condition, weather protection of exterior surfaces, driveway and sidewalk condition and accessory building condition.
  6. Ability to clearly communicate to property owners, contractors and the general public; explain and interpret requirements and restrictions of adopted codes and ordinances related to residential construction.
  7. Receive calls and answer questions about licenses, permits and code requirements; direct inquiries as necessary relating to residential maintenance and construction.
  8. Retrieve license and permit information from the computer; verify legal data including owners, tax records, and other data needed to issue permits and notify property owners of corrective actions necessary to gain code compliance.
  9. Maintain files and reports regarding inspection activities and findings.
  10. Testify in court as necessary. Drive to and from destinations as assigned.
  11. Inspect plumbing, mechanical, electrical systems and varied other building component systems of residences for approval of rental property license programs.
E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E
 
High School Diploma/GED and two (2) years of increasingly responsible housing code inspection, multi-family inspections, property/construction management, project coordination or building maintenance, repair and construction experience and/or building inspection experience and have the ability to detect violations to minimum property standards. 
 
LICENSES AND CERTIFICATES
 
Possession of a valid driver’s license.
 
Possession of International Code Council Property Maintenance Code Certification or ability to obtain within one year of employment. 
 
Possession of a State of Texas Code Enforcement Registration or ability to obtain within 6 months of employment.
WORK SCHEDULE
Monday- Friday 8am-5pm.
